TEAM TERABYTE Onboard Diagnostics System
TEAM MEMBERS Yuanchun Zhao Project Facilitator Jon Rietveld Project Manager Kyle Bartush Artifacts Manager Brandon D’Orazio Customer Liaison
Dr. Ed Nelson Ford Motor Company Innovation Center Dr. Betty HC Cheng Instructor
PRESENTATION AGENDA 1) CAN bus Overview 2) OBD System Overview 3) Module Overview 4) UML Models 5) Prototype Demonstration
DOMAIN RESEARCH Online Sources CiA (CAN in Automation) Machine Bus OBD II Background Personal Sources Dr. Ed Nelson
CAN BUS OVERVIEW Controller Area Network Messaging system 6-byte Message Format Universal Broadcast
OBD SYSTEM OVERVIEW Onboard Diagnostics System Purpose: Detect, log and display errors Functions: Log errors Transmit and receive messages Run self tests Focus: Camera Radar
USE CASE
DOMAIN MODEL
SEQUENCE DIAGRAMS
STATE DIAGRAM
PROTOTYPE DEMONSTRATION